The Department of Geography and Environmental Studies has been at the forefront of Toronto Metropolitan University’s development from a technical training institute to a comprehensive public university. Our BA in Geographic Analysis was the first stand-alone degree granted at the university, starting as a BAA in Applied Geography in the early 1970s. Our MSA in Spatial Analysis was the first Department-based graduate degree offered at Toronto Metropolitan University, and we were also heavily involved in another one of Toronto Metropolitan University’s first three graduate degrees, the MASc in Environmental Applied Science and Management (now also offering a PhD degree). With the recent introduction of our BA in Environment and Urban Sustainability, we are one of the largest departments in the Faculty of Arts and one of the largest Geography departments in Canada by undergraduate specialist and Master's student enrolments. Our contributions to interdisciplinary graduate degreesliberal studies and professionally related courses, as well as continuing education certificates are also continuously expanding.

Our research spans the breadth of Geography, from human-social to physical-environmental themes. We are widely known for our expertise in developing and using geospatial data and Geographic Information Systems (GIS). Our toolkit includes a wide range of commercial and open-source GIS software as well as remote sensing, GPS, graphics, and statistical packages. Quantitative, qualitative, and mixed-methods research @RyersonGeo contributes to better government decision-making and planning; more efficient business operations; and more effective non-profit activities.
